Compiler hygiene (all platforms):
- Silence warnings across the tree: missing override, -Wreorder ctor
  init, -Wshadow, -Wsign-compare, missing switch cases, unused
  functions/captures, Qt 6.11 deprecations (QMouseEvent/QDropEvent
  accessors, qAsConst, Q_FOREACH over non-shared containers,
  AA_UseHighDpiPixmaps) and the .bak/ backup tree removal.
- Fix regressions from the cleanup: missing clip decls in
  capi/timeline.cpp, plugin.cpp rename fallout, panel setFocus
  ambiguity, QGraphicsItem::pos vs event->position(), duplicate
  k_push_button case, boolean test variable.

Windows:
- Qt portability: CommandLineParser is_set/add_option, QTimeZone
  systemTimeZone (QTimeZone::LocalTime is 6.11-only), k_progress_* enum.
- Linking: stop adding oakengine to OLIVE_LIBRARIES (import lib plus
  oakengine-obj caused multiple definitions); add OAKENGINE_STATIC so
  internal consumers no longer reference __imp_* stubs.
- oakengine.ver: export olive::Renderer typeinfo so liboakgl.so can be
  dlopened (Linux), DynamicRenderer no longer dlcloses backend libraries
  (crash in RenderManager's dtor calling into unmapped memory).
- OTIO runtime: copy DLLs next to every binary on Windows instead of
  relying on PATH (0xc0000135 in gtest discovery).
- Headless GL: the runner only has GDI OpenGL 1.1, killing every render
  worker. Deploy Mesa llvmpipe as opengl32sw.dll (Qt's software-GL
  channel) with QT_OPENGL=software, and let QT_OPENGL override the
  AA_UseDesktopOpenGL default. ExportTask fails fast after 8 consecutive
  undelivered frames instead of segfaulting or grinding forever;
  FFmpegEncoder::write_frame tolerates null frames.
- Tests: GetTempPathA+PID temp dirs, GetLongPathNameA for 8.3 names,
  forward-slash normalization when comparing project filenames.

Linux:
- Install libshaderc-dev so oakvulkan compiles GLSL (Vulkan tests).
- Accept UNORM floor-or-round (63/64) in the blit ping-pong test.
- Skip MainWindow construction test on the offscreen QPA (cannot paint
  QOpenGLWidget).

Also: oak_cli_transcode gets a 300s ctest timeout, worker logs GL
context version and LoadGraph/render_frame stages, and
docs/plans/eliminate-event-bridge-issues.md (English translation).

#include <gtest/gtest.h>
#include <QDebug>
#include <QTemporaryDir>
#include <QTemporaryFile>
#include "common/filefunctions.h"
namespace
{
// Collects qDebug/qWarning/qCritical output for inspection
QStringList g_captured_messages;
void capture_message_handler(QtMsgType, const QMessageLogContext &,
const QString &msg)
{
g_captured_messages.append(msg);
}
} // namespace
TEST(CommonFileFunctions, EnsureFilenameExtension)
{
EXPECT_EQ(olive::FileFunctions::ensure_filename_extension(
QStringLiteral("project"), QStringLiteral("ove")),
QStringLiteral("project.ove"));
EXPECT_EQ(olive::FileFunctions::ensure_filename_extension(
QStringLiteral("project.ove"), QStringLiteral("ove")),
QStringLiteral("project.ove"));
EXPECT_EQ(olive::FileFunctions::ensure_filename_extension(
QStringLiteral("PROJECT"), QStringLiteral("ove")),
QStringLiteral("PROJECT.ove"));
EXPECT_TRUE(olive::FileFunctions::ensure_filename_extension(
QString(), QStringLiteral("ove"))
.isEmpty());
EXPECT_EQ(olive::FileFunctions::ensure_filename_extension(
QStringLiteral("project"), QString()),
QStringLiteral("project"));
}
TEST(CommonFileFunctions, GetSafeTemporaryFilename)
{
QTemporaryDir dir;
ASSERT_TRUE(dir.isValid());
QString base = dir.filePath(QStringLiteral("test.ove"));
QString first = olive::FileFunctions::get_safe_temporary_filename(base);
EXPECT_FALSE(QFileInfo::exists(first));
EXPECT_TRUE(first.contains(QStringLiteral(".tmp0.")));
QFile f(first);
(void)f.open(QIODevice::WriteOnly);
f.close();
QString second = olive::FileFunctions::get_safe_temporary_filename(base);
EXPECT_NE(first, second);
EXPECT_TRUE(second.contains(QStringLiteral(".tmp1.")));
}
TEST(CommonFileFunctions, DirectoryIsValid)
{
QTemporaryDir dir;
ASSERT_TRUE(dir.isValid());
EXPECT_TRUE(
olive::FileFunctions::directory_is_valid(QDir(dir.path()), false));
QDir nonexistent(dir.filePath(QStringLiteral("subdir/nested")));
EXPECT_TRUE(olive::FileFunctions::directory_is_valid(nonexistent, true));
EXPECT_TRUE(nonexistent.exists());
}
TEST(CommonFileFunctions, RenameFileAllowOverwrite)
{
QTemporaryDir dir;
ASSERT_TRUE(dir.isValid());
QString from = dir.filePath(QStringLiteral("from.txt"));
QString to = dir.filePath(QStringLiteral("to.txt"));
QFile f(from);
(void)f.open(QIODevice::WriteOnly);
f.write("source");
f.close();
QFile t(to);
(void)t.open(QIODevice::WriteOnly);
t.write("existing");
t.close();
EXPECT_TRUE(olive::FileFunctions::rename_file_allow_overwrite(from, to));
EXPECT_FALSE(QFileInfo::exists(from));
QFile result(to);
(void)result.open(QIODevice::ReadOnly);
EXPECT_EQ(result.readAll(), QByteArray("source"));
}
TEST(CommonFileFunctions, CanCopyDirectoryWithoutOverwriting)
{
QTemporaryDir src;
QTemporaryDir dst;
ASSERT_TRUE(src.isValid());
ASSERT_TRUE(dst.isValid());
QString src_file = QDir(src.path()).filePath(QStringLiteral("file.txt"));
QFile f(src_file);
(void)f.open(QIODevice::WriteOnly);
f.close();
EXPECT_TRUE(olive::FileFunctions::can_copy_directory_without_overwriting(
src.path(), dst.path()));
QString dst_file = QDir(dst.path()).filePath(QStringLiteral("file.txt"));
QFile g(dst_file);
(void)g.open(QIODevice::WriteOnly);
g.close();
EXPECT_FALSE(olive::FileFunctions::can_copy_directory_without_overwriting(
src.path(), dst.path()));
}
TEST(CommonFileFunctions, CopyDirectory)
{
QTemporaryDir src;
QTemporaryDir dst;
ASSERT_TRUE(src.isValid());
ASSERT_TRUE(dst.isValid());
QString src_file = QDir(src.path()).filePath(QStringLiteral("file.txt"));
QFile f(src_file);
(void)f.open(QIODevice::WriteOnly);
f.write("copied");
f.close();
QString dst_dir = QDir(dst.path()).filePath(QStringLiteral("copied"));
olive::FileFunctions::copy_directory(src.path(), dst_dir, false);
QFile result(QDir(dst_dir).filePath(QStringLiteral("file.txt")));
EXPECT_TRUE(result.open(QIODevice::ReadOnly));
EXPECT_EQ(result.readAll(), QByteArray("copied"));
}
TEST(CommonFileFunctions, ReadFileAsString)
{
QTemporaryFile f;
ASSERT_TRUE(f.open());
f.write("hello world");
f.close();
EXPECT_EQ(olive::FileFunctions::read_file_as_string(f.fileName()),
QStringLiteral("hello world"));
EXPECT_TRUE(olive::FileFunctions::read_file_as_string(
QStringLiteral("/nonexistent/path"))
.isEmpty());
}
TEST(CommonFileFunctions, GetUniqueFileIdentifier)
{
QTemporaryFile f;
ASSERT_TRUE(f.open());
f.close();
QString id1 = olive::FileFunctions::get_unique_file_identifier(f.fileName());
QString id2 = olive::FileFunctions::get_unique_file_identifier(f.fileName());
EXPECT_FALSE(id1.isEmpty());
EXPECT_EQ(id1, id2);
EXPECT_TRUE(olive::FileFunctions::get_unique_file_identifier(
QStringLiteral("/nonexistent"))
.isEmpty());
}
TEST(CommonFileFunctions, GetConfigurationLocation)
{
QString loc = olive::FileFunctions::get_configuration_location();
EXPECT_FALSE(loc.isEmpty());
EXPECT_TRUE(QDir(loc).exists());
}
TEST(CommonFileFunctions, GetTempFilePath)
{
QString temp = olive::FileFunctions::get_temp_file_path();
EXPECT_FALSE(temp.isEmpty());
EXPECT_TRUE(QDir(temp).exists());
}
TEST(CommonFileFunctions, GetAutoRecoveryRoot)
{
QString root = olive::FileFunctions::get_auto_recovery_root();
EXPECT_FALSE(root.isEmpty());
}
TEST(CommonFileFunctions, DirectoryIsValidExisting)
{
QTemporaryDir dir;
ASSERT_TRUE(dir.isValid());
EXPECT_TRUE(
olive::FileFunctions::directory_is_valid(QDir(dir.path()), false));
}
TEST(CommonFileFunctions, CopyDirectoryWithOverwrite)
{
QTemporaryDir src;
QTemporaryDir dst;
ASSERT_TRUE(src.isValid());
ASSERT_TRUE(dst.isValid());
QString src_file = QDir(src.path()).filePath(QStringLiteral("file.txt"));
QFile f(src_file);
(void)f.open(QIODevice::WriteOnly);
f.write("new content");
f.close();
QString dst_file = QDir(dst.path()).filePath(QStringLiteral("file.txt"));
QFile g(dst_file);
(void)g.open(QIODevice::WriteOnly);
g.write("old content");
g.close();
olive::FileFunctions::copy_directory(src.path(), dst.path(), true);
QFile result(dst_file);
(void)result.open(QIODevice::ReadOnly);
EXPECT_EQ(result.readAll(), QByteArray("new content"));
}
TEST(CommonFileFunctions, CopyDirectorySourceMissing)
{
QTemporaryDir dst;
ASSERT_TRUE(dst.isValid());
// A missing source must log a critical error naming the source and
// leave the destination untouched
g_captured_messages.clear();
QtMessageHandler old = qInstallMessageHandler(capture_message_handler);
olive::FileFunctions::copy_directory(QStringLiteral("/nonexistent/path"),
dst.path(), false);
qInstallMessageHandler(old);
ASSERT_EQ(g_captured_messages.size(), 1);
EXPECT_TRUE(g_captured_messages.first().contains(
QStringLiteral("Failed to copy directory")));
EXPECT_TRUE(g_captured_messages.first().contains(
QStringLiteral("/nonexistent/path")));
EXPECT_TRUE(
QDir(dst.path()).entryList(QDir::NoDotAndDotDot).isEmpty());
}
